Traceroute is a community diagnostic device used to find out the trail taken by packets throughout an IP community. It operates by sending a collection of packets to a specified vacation spot host, every with a special IP time to reside (TTL) worth. Because the packets traverse the community, every router decrements the TTL subject by one. When the TTL reaches zero, the router sends an ICMP Time Exceeded message again to the supply host. By analyzing the sequence of ICMP messages, traceroute can decide the route taken by the packets and determine any community issues alongside the best way.
Traceroute is a crucial device for community directors and engineers. It may be used to troubleshoot community connectivity points, determine community bottlenecks, and map the topology of a community. Traceroute may also be used to determine safety vulnerabilities, equivalent to open ports or misconfigured routers.
Traceroute has been round for a few years and is a extensively used device. It’s obtainable on most working programs and can be utilized with quite a lot of community protocols, together with IPv4 and IPv6.
1. Diagnostic device
Traceroute is a beneficial device for community directors and engineers. It may be used to troubleshoot community connectivity points, determine community bottlenecks, and map the topology of a community. As a diagnostic device, traceroute may help to determine the supply of community issues and decide one of the best plan of action to resolve them.
- Figuring out community connectivity points: Traceroute can be utilized to determine community connectivity points by sending a collection of packets to a specified vacation spot host and analyzing the responses. If a packet is misplaced or dropped, traceroute will report the situation of the issue. This data can be utilized to determine the supply of the issue and decide one of the best plan of action to resolve it.
- Figuring out community bottlenecks: Traceroute can be utilized to determine community bottlenecks by measuring the time it takes for packets to journey throughout a community. If a packet experiences a major delay, it could point out that there’s a bottleneck on the community. This data can be utilized to determine the situation of the bottleneck and decide one of the best plan of action to resolve it.
- Mapping the topology of a community: Traceroute can be utilized to map the topology of a community by sending a collection of packets to a specified vacation spot host and analyzing the responses. The trail that the packets take can be utilized to create a map of the community. This data can be utilized to determine potential issues and plan for future community progress.
Traceroute is a robust device that can be utilized to troubleshoot quite a lot of community issues. By understanding how traceroute works, you should use it to successfully determine and resolve community issues.
2. Path willpower
Traceroute is a community diagnostic device that can be utilized to troubleshoot community connectivity points, determine community bottlenecks, and map the topology of a community. One of many key options of traceroute is its skill to find out the trail taken by packets throughout an IP community. This data could be beneficial for community directors and engineers, as it might assist them to determine and resolve community issues.
- Figuring out community connectivity points: Traceroute can be utilized to determine community connectivity points by sending a collection of packets to a specified vacation spot host and analyzing the responses. If a packet is misplaced or dropped, traceroute will report the situation of the issue. This data can be utilized to determine the supply of the issue and decide one of the best plan of action to resolve it.
- Figuring out community bottlenecks: Traceroute can be utilized to determine community bottlenecks by measuring the time it takes for packets to journey throughout a community. If a packet experiences a major delay, it could point out that there’s a bottleneck on the community. This data can be utilized to determine the situation of the bottleneck and decide one of the best plan of action to resolve it.
- Mapping the topology of a community: Traceroute can be utilized to map the topology of a community by sending a collection of packets to a specified vacation spot host and analyzing the responses. The trail that the packets take can be utilized to create a map of the community. This data can be utilized to determine potential issues and plan for future community progress.
The flexibility to find out the trail taken by packets throughout an IP community is among the key options of traceroute. This data could be beneficial for community directors and engineers, as it might assist them to determine and resolve community issues.
3. Community bottlenecks
Traceroute is a beneficial device for figuring out community bottlenecks. A community bottleneck is some extent in a community the place there’s a important discount in bandwidth or throughput. This may be brought on by quite a lot of elements, together with congested hyperlinks, gradual {hardware}, or misconfigured community units.
-
Figuring out bottlenecks utilizing traceroute
Traceroute can be utilized to determine community bottlenecks by measuring the time it takes for packets to journey throughout a community. If a packet experiences a major delay, it could point out that there’s a bottleneck on the community. This data can be utilized to determine the situation of the bottleneck and decide one of the best plan of action to resolve it.
-
Actual-life examples of community bottlenecks
Community bottlenecks can happen in quite a lot of real-life conditions. For instance, a community bottleneck could happen when there’s a excessive quantity of visitors on a specific hyperlink, when a {hardware} gadget is overloaded, or when a community gadget is misconfigured.
-
Implications of community bottlenecks
Community bottlenecks can have a major affect on the efficiency of a community. They’ll trigger slowdowns, delays, and even outages. Figuring out and resolving community bottlenecks is crucial for sustaining a high-performing community.
Traceroute is a robust device that can be utilized to determine and resolve community bottlenecks. By understanding how traceroute works, you should use it to successfully enhance the efficiency of your community.
4. Community mapping
Traceroute is a beneficial device for community mapping. Community mapping is the method of making a diagram or map of a community. This may be helpful for quite a lot of functions, equivalent to planning community upgrades, troubleshooting community issues, and figuring out safety vulnerabilities.
-
Parts of community mapping
Community mapping includes figuring out the elements of a community, equivalent to routers, switches, servers, and workstations. It additionally includes figuring out the connections between these units.
-
Examples of community mapping
Community mapping can be utilized to create quite a lot of various kinds of diagrams and maps. For instance, a community map may present the bodily format of a community, the logical format of a community, or the visitors stream on a community.
-
Implications of community mapping
Community mapping can have a major affect on the efficiency of a community. By understanding the topology of a community, community directors can determine and resolve issues extra shortly and effectively.
-
Traceroute and community mapping
Traceroute is a beneficial device for community mapping. Traceroute can be utilized to determine the trail taken by packets throughout a community. This data can be utilized to create a map of the community and determine potential issues.
Community mapping is a necessary job for community directors. By understanding the topology of a community, community directors can enhance the efficiency of a community and determine and resolve issues extra shortly and effectively.
5. Safety
Traceroute is a beneficial device for figuring out safety vulnerabilities on a community. By sending a collection of packets to a specified vacation spot host and analyzing the responses, traceroute can determine open ports and misconfigured routers, which could be potential entry factors for attackers.
-
Figuring out open ports
Open ports are ports on a pc or community gadget which might be listening for incoming connections. If an open port isn’t correctly configured, it may be exploited by attackers to realize unauthorized entry to the gadget.
-
Figuring out misconfigured routers
Misconfigured routers may also be a safety danger. For instance, a router that isn’t correctly configured could permit unauthorized entry to the community or could not be capable to defend the community from denial-of-service assaults.
-
Actual-life examples
There have been a number of real-life examples of attackers exploiting open ports and misconfigured routers to realize unauthorized entry to networks and programs. For instance, in 2017, the WannaCry ransomware assault exploited a vulnerability in Microsoft Home windows to contaminate over 200,000 computer systems worldwide.
-
Implications
Open ports and misconfigured routers can have a major affect on the safety of a community. By figuring out and resolving these vulnerabilities, organizations can scale back the danger of being attacked.
Traceroute is a robust device that can be utilized to determine safety vulnerabilities on a community. By understanding how traceroute works, organizations can use it to enhance the safety of their networks and defend them from assault.
6. IP community
Traceroute is a community diagnostic device that’s used to find out the trail taken by packets throughout an IP community. It really works by sending a collection of packets to a specified vacation spot host, every with a special IP time to reside (TTL) worth. The TTL worth is a subject within the IP header that specifies the utmost variety of routers {that a} packet can cross by way of earlier than it’s discarded. Because the packets traverse the community, every router decrements the TTL subject by one. When the TTL reaches zero, the router sends an ICMP Time Exceeded message again to the supply host. By analyzing the sequence of ICMP messages, traceroute can decide the route taken by the packets and determine any community issues alongside the best way.
-
Parts of traceroute
The principle elements of traceroute are the supply host, the vacation spot host, and the routers in between. The supply host is the pc that’s sending the traceroute packets. The vacation spot host is the pc that’s receiving the traceroute packets. The routers are the units that ahead the traceroute packets from the supply host to the vacation spot host.
-
Examples of traceroute
Traceroute can be utilized to troubleshoot quite a lot of community issues. For instance, traceroute can be utilized to determine the supply of a community outage, to determine the trail taken by packets throughout a community, or to determine community bottlenecks.
-
Implications of traceroute
Traceroute is a beneficial device for community directors and engineers. It may be used to troubleshoot community issues, enhance the efficiency of a community, and determine safety vulnerabilities.
In conclusion, traceroute is a robust device that can be utilized to diagnose and resolve community issues. By understanding how traceroute works, community directors and engineers can use it to enhance the efficiency of their networks and preserve them operating easily.
Traceroute FAQs
Traceroute is a robust device that can be utilized to diagnose and resolve community issues. It’s a beneficial device for community directors and engineers, however it may also be helpful for house customers who’re experiencing community issues.
Query 1: What’s traceroute?
Traceroute is a community diagnostic device that’s used to find out the trail taken by packets throughout an IP community. It really works by sending a collection of packets to a specified vacation spot host, every with a special IP time to reside (TTL) worth. The TTL worth is a subject within the IP header that specifies the utmost variety of routers {that a} packet can cross by way of earlier than it’s discarded. Because the packets traverse the community, every router decrements the TTL subject by one. When the TTL reaches zero, the router sends an ICMP Time Exceeded message again to the supply host. By analyzing the sequence of ICMP messages, traceroute can decide the route taken by the packets and determine any community issues alongside the best way.
Query 2: How do I exploit traceroute?
Traceroute is a command-line device that’s obtainable on most working programs. To make use of traceroute, merely open a command immediate and kind “traceroute” adopted by the hostname or IP handle of the vacation spot host. For instance, to hint the path to google.com, you’ll kind the next command:
traceroute google.com
Query 3: What data does traceroute present?
Traceroute supplies a variety of totally different items of data, together with:
- The IP handle of every router that the packets cross by way of
- The time it takes for every packet to succeed in every router
- The variety of hops that every packet takes to succeed in the vacation spot host
Query 4: How can I exploit traceroute to troubleshoot community issues?
Traceroute can be utilized to troubleshoot quite a lot of community issues, equivalent to:
- Figuring out community connectivity points
- Figuring out community bottlenecks
- Mapping the topology of a community
- Figuring out safety vulnerabilities
Query 5: Are there any limitations to traceroute?
Traceroute is a beneficial device, however it does have some limitations. For instance, traceroute can’t be used to hint the path to a vacation spot host that’s behind a firewall. Moreover, traceroute could be affected by community congestion and different elements that may affect the efficiency of the community.
Query 6: What are some alternate options to traceroute?
There are a variety of various alternate options to traceroute, together with:
- ping
- mtr
- tcpdump
Every of those instruments has its personal strengths and weaknesses, so it is very important select the best device for the job.
Abstract
Traceroute is a robust device that can be utilized to diagnose and resolve community issues. It’s a beneficial device for community directors and engineers, however it may also be helpful for house customers who’re experiencing community issues.
Subsequent Steps
In case you are experiencing community issues, traceroute could be a beneficial device for troubleshooting the issue. By understanding how traceroute works and tips on how to use it, you should use it to enhance the efficiency of your community and preserve it operating easily.
Traceroute Ideas
Traceroute is a robust device that can be utilized to diagnose and resolve community issues. By understanding how traceroute works and tips on how to use it successfully, you should use it to enhance the efficiency of your community and preserve it operating easily.
Tip 1: Use traceroute to determine community connectivity points.
Traceroute can be utilized to determine community connectivity points by sending a collection of packets to a specified vacation spot host and analyzing the responses. If a packet is misplaced or dropped, traceroute will report the situation of the issue. This data can be utilized to determine the supply of the issue and decide one of the best plan of action to resolve it.
Tip 2: Use traceroute to determine community bottlenecks.
Traceroute can be utilized to determine community bottlenecks by measuring the time it takes for packets to journey throughout a community. If a packet experiences a major delay, it could point out that there’s a bottleneck on the community. This data can be utilized to determine the situation of the bottleneck and decide one of the best plan of action to resolve it.
Tip 3: Use traceroute to map the topology of a community.
Traceroute can be utilized to map the topology of a community by sending a collection of packets to a specified vacation spot host and analyzing the responses. The trail that the packets take can be utilized to create a map of the community. This data can be utilized to determine potential issues and plan for future community progress.
Tip 4: Use traceroute to determine safety vulnerabilities.
Traceroute can be utilized to determine safety vulnerabilities on a community by sending a collection of packets to a specified vacation spot host and analyzing the responses. Traceroute can determine open ports and misconfigured routers, which could be potential entry factors for attackers.
Tip 5: Use traceroute to troubleshoot community issues.
Traceroute can be utilized to troubleshoot quite a lot of community issues, equivalent to slowdowns, delays, and outages. By understanding how traceroute works and tips on how to use it successfully, you should use it to determine and resolve community issues shortly and effectively.
Abstract
Traceroute is a robust device that can be utilized to diagnose and resolve community issues. By understanding how traceroute works and tips on how to use it successfully, you should use it to enhance the efficiency of your community and preserve it operating easily.
Subsequent Steps
In case you are experiencing community issues, traceroute could be a beneficial device for troubleshooting the issue. By understanding how traceroute works and tips on how to use it, you should use it to enhance the efficiency of your community and preserve it operating easily.
Conclusion
Traceroute is a robust device that can be utilized to diagnose and resolve community issues. It’s a beneficial device for community directors and engineers, however it may also be helpful for house customers who’re experiencing community issues.
Traceroute can be utilized to determine community connectivity points, determine community bottlenecks, map the topology of a community, and determine safety vulnerabilities. By understanding how traceroute works and tips on how to use it successfully, you should use it to enhance the efficiency of your community and preserve it operating easily.
In conclusion, traceroute is a necessary device for anybody who needs to know and troubleshoot community issues.